I made some minor changes to SMTPcommands.nse (attached). In addition to querying the mail server with EHLO, it now also queries with HELP because the two commands give similar but different results. Addressing a complaint I still have not fixed in the comments -- EHLO returns a multiline result - I would like to pull out the line feeds and replace them with -- something nicer like commas. But when I do that, it messes up the first two lines as well, which -- probably should be on their own lines. I have not mastered the regexes for NSE yet, so maybe some day. It looks like this Interesting ports on mail.domain.com (xx.xx.xx.xx): PORT STATE SERVICE VERSION 25/tcp open smtp Microsoft ESMTP 6.0.3790.1830 | SMTP: Responded to EHLO command | MAIL.domain.com Hello [yy.yy.yy.yy] | TURN | SIZE | ETRN | PIPELINING | DSN | ENHANCEDSTATUSCODES | 8bitmime | BINARYMIME | CHUNKING | VRFY | X-EXPS GSSAPI NTLM LOGIN | X-EXPS=LOGIN | AUTH GSSAPI NTLM LOGIN | AUTH=LOGIN | X-LINK2STATE | XEXCH50 | Responded to HELP command | This server supports the following commands: |_ HELO EHLO STARTTLS RCPT DATA RSET MAIL QUIT HELP AUTH TURN ETRN BDAT VRFY Sorry I didn't send this up until *after* SOC7.
